If sec(theta) =25/24, find cot(theta) (Picture provided)

Step-by-step explanation:

By the definition,

\sec \theta=\dfrac{\text{hypotenuse}}{\text{adjacent leg}}.

If \sec \theta=\dfrac{25}{24}, we can consider right triangle with hypotenuse 25 un. and adjacent leg 24 un. By the Pythagorean theorem,

\text{hypotenuse}^2=\text{adjacent leg}^2+\text{opposite leg}^2,\\ \\\text{opposite leg}^2=25^2-24^2,\\ \\\text{opposite leg}^2=625-576,\\ \\\text{opposite leg}^2=49,\\ \\\text{opposite leg}=7\ un.

So,

\cot \theta=\dfrac{\text{adjacent leg}}{\text{opposite leg}}=\dfrac{24}{7}.
